Aulnois-en-Perthois is a commune in the Meuse department in the Grand Est region in northeastern France.
Year | Pop. | ±% p.a. |
---|---|---|
1968 | 360 | — |
1975 | 331 | −1.19% |
1982 | 376 | +1.84% |
1990 | 413 | +1.18% |
1999 | 421 | +0.21% |
2009 | 475 | +1.21% |
2014 | 519 | +1.79% |
2020 | 489 | −0.99% |
Source: INSEE [3] |
